Core Ingredients & Tools
Ingredient List (Exact Measurements)
| Ingredient | Amount |
|---|---|
| Bonein chicken thighs | 2large (about 500g) |
| Water | 6cups (1.5L) |
| Yellow onion, quartered | 1medium |
| Garlic cloves, smashed | 3 |
| Carrot, sliced | 1medium |
| Bay leaf | 1 |
| Fresh thyme | 2sprigs |
| Sea salt | tsp (adjust to taste) |
| Black pepper | tsp |
Substitutions & Why They Work
- Use chicken breast for a leaner broth (but expect slightly less gelatin).
- Swap carrots for celery if you prefer a more aromatic profile.
- For a vegetarian clear soup, replace chicken with a mix of dried shiitake mushrooms and kombu seaweedthe umami stays, the broth stays clear.

StepbyStep Procedure
Preparation
Rinse the chicken thighs under cold water and pat dry. Peel and quarter the onion, smash the garlic, and slice the carrot. Having everything ready makes the cooking process feel like a breeze.
Cooking Steps
- Saut aromatics: Turn the InstantPot to Saut, add a splash of oil, then toss in the onion and garlic. Cook 23 minutes until fragrant. (You can skip this step for an ultraclear broth.)
- Add the rest: Place the chicken thighs, carrot, bay leaf, thyme, salt, and pepper into the pot. Pour in the water, making sure the chicken is fully submerged.
- Seal & pressurecook: Close the lid, set to Manual high pressure for 12 minutes. If youre using a stovetop, bring to a gentle boil, then lower to a simmer for 45 minutes.
- Release pressure: Quickrelease the steam, remove the chicken, and set aside for later use (shred it back in if you like).
- Strain the broth: Using a finemesh strainer lined with cheesecloth, pour the liquid into a clean container. Discard the solids; youve just captured the purest broth possible.
- Optional finishing touches: Add a drizzle of sesame oil for a restaurantstyle twist, or garnish with sliced spring onions for a fresh pop.
Pro Tip: Keep It Crystal Clear
Dont let the broth boil hardgentle simmering prevents emulsified fats that cloud the soup. Skim any foam that rises during cooking; its mostly protein that can turn the broth milky.

How to Adapt the Core Recipe
- RestaurantStyle: After straining, stir in cup dry white wine and a teaspoon of toasted sesame oil. Heat briefly, then serve with a sprinkle of chopped cilantro.
- Chinese Version: Add 2thin slices of ginger and a handful of sliced bokchoy during the last 5 minutes of cooking. Finish with a splash of lowsodium soy sauce and sliced scallions.
- Veg Clear Soup: Substitute 200g dried shiitake mushrooms (rehydrated) and 1piece kombu for the chicken. Follow the same 12minute pressure cook; the umami stays bright.
- Colonoscopy Prep: Omit oil and any fatty cuts; use only a pinch of salt and a dash of pepper. Keep the broth clear and low in residue.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use a whole chicken?
Absolutely! A whole chicken yields a richer broth but requires a longer cooking timeabout 25minutes at high pressure. Just remember to remove the meat before straining.
How long does the broth stay clear?
If stored in a sealed container in the fridge, it stays crystal clear for up to 3days. Chill quickly after cooking and avoid reheating at a rolling boil; a gentle warm-up keeps the clarity.
Is this soup safe for colonoscopy prep?
Yes, when you follow the clear soup recipe colonoscopy guidelines: no solid pieces, lowfat, lowresidue ingredients, and minimal seasoning. The clear liquids guidance also advises a clearliquid diet the day before the procedure, and this broth fits the bill.
Can I freeze the clear broth?
Definitely. Freeze in portionsize containers (about 1cup each). Thaw in the fridge overnight and reheat gently; the flavor actually deepens after a freezethaw cycle.

Balancing Benefits Risks
Potential Risks
Even a gentle soup can pose issues if not handled right. Undercooked chicken can harbor Salmonella; always ensure the internal temperature reaches 165F (74C). High sodium may be a concern for those with hypertensionadjust the salt or use a lowsodium broth base.
